Refrigerated Centrifuge Sigma 3-30KS 2 Layout and mode of operation → Mode of operation → 2.2.1 Centrifugation principle Centrifugation is a process for the separation of heterogeneous mixtures of substances (suspensions, emulsions, or gas mixtures) into their components. The mixture of substances, which rotates on a circular path, is subject to centripetal acceleration that is several times greater than the gravitational acceleration.
Refrigerated Centrifuge Sigma 3-30KS 2 Layout and mode of operation → 2.2.2.1 Speed, radius, and relative centrifugal force The acceleration g, which the samples are subject to, can be increased by increasing the radius in the rotor chamber and by increasing the speed.

CAUTION Sigma centrifuges are units of protection class I. The centrifuges of this model series have a three-wire power cord with a fixed cable. They are equipped with a mains power switch with an integrated thermal circuit breaker.
Refrigerated Centrifuge Sigma 3-30KS 5 Set-up and connection 5.2.2 Customer-provided fuses Typically, centrifuges with a nominal voltage of 220-240 V must be protected with 16 Amp B fuses that are to be provided by the customer. Centrifuges with a nominal voltage of 200 V or 208 V must be protected on site with a 16 Amp type D circuit breaker.

Refrigerated Centrifuge Sigma 3-30KS 6 Using the centrifuge Density This setting is useful for glass vessels. If the density of the liquid to be centrifuged is higher than 1.2 g/cm , the value must be adapted manually in order to prevent the glass vessel from breaking. This will reduce the maximum possible final speed (see chapter 2.2.2.2 - "Density").

Refrigerated Centrifuge Sigma 3-30KS 8 Maintenance and service → 8.1.1.1 Condenser (only refrigerated centrifuges with an air-cooled refrigeration system) In order to cool the refrigerant that is compressed by the refrigeration unit, centrifuges with an air-cooled refrigeration system use a lamellar condenser.
Refrigerated Centrifuge Sigma 3-30KS 8 Maintenance and service → 8.1.2.1 Plastic accessories The chemical resistance of plastic decreases with rising temperatures (see chapter 11.5 - "Resistance data"). • If solvents, acids, or alkaline solutions have been used, clean the plastic accessories thoroughly.
Refrigerated Centrifuge Sigma 3-30KS 8 Maintenance and service → 8.1.4 Load bearing bolts Only greased load-bearing bolts ensure a uniform swing-out of the buckets and, therefore, the smooth operation of the centrifuge. Load-bearing bolts that are insufficiently greased may cause the centrifuge to stop due to an imbalance.
Refrigerated Centrifuge Sigma 3-30KS 8 Maintenance and service → 8.1.5 Glass breakage In the case of glass breakage, immediately remove all glass particles (e.g. with a vacuum cleaner). Replace the rubber cushions since even thorough cleaning will not remove all glass particles.
